Average Market Value In Sydney Central Business District

Discover an accurate property market values with Cockatoo’s expert guidance.
The property market in Sydney CBD has experienced moderate growth post-pandemic, with strong interest from investors and continued demand for high-density apartments. House prices are rarely relevant as standalone homes are scarce, while median unit prices have shown slight increases in 2023–2024.

3200000

Median House Price

3.1 %

House Price Growth

930000

Median Unit Price

2.2 %

Unit Price Growth

Lifestyle and Amenities In and Around Sydney Central Business District

Sydney Central Business District Lifestyle: Why Live Here
Sydney CBD offers a vibrant urban lifestyle with access to world-class dining, shopping, cultural institutions, entertainment venues, parks, and waterfront promenades. Residents and visitors enjoy close proximity to major attractions like Circular Quay, Darling Harbour, and the Royal Botanic Garden, complemented by excellent public transport infrastructure.
